1A physical stimulus that acts on the skin, nerves, or senses and provokes a reaction, such as irritation.
唐辛子は舌に強い刺激を与える。
Chili peppers give a strong stimulus to the tongue.
この薬品は目に刺激があるので、手袋をして扱ってください。
This chemical is irritating to the eyes, so please handle it with gloves.
日焼け止めが肌に合わず、刺激を感じた。
The sunscreen didn't suit my skin, and I felt irritation.
強い光は目に刺激を与えることがある。
Bright light can be irritating to the eyes.
2Something that serves as a trigger or motivation for action; an incentive that encourages or spurs someone on.
先輩の成功が私にとって大きな刺激になった。
My senior's success was a huge motivator for me.
留学は彼のキャリアに新しい刺激を与えた。
Studying abroad gave a fresh stimulus to his career.
たまには環境を変えることが良い刺激になる。
Changing your environment once in a while can be a good stimulus.
3A strong sensation of excitement or thrill that stirs the emotions.
絶叫マシンは刺激を求める人に人気だ。
Thrill rides are popular with people seeking excitement.
毎日同じことの繰り返しで、もっと刺激が欲しい。
My days are the same repetitive routine, and I want more excitement.
